Falease'elā is a village on the Southwest coast of island in . the village is part of Lefaga ma Faleaseela Electoral Constituency which forms part of the larger A'ana political district. is situated 4½ miles east of Falelatai Reef.

is a village on the north-western tip of the island of , in . In the modern era, it is the capital of district. wharf is the main ferry terminal for inter-island vehicle and passenger travel across the between Upolu and the island of Savai'i. is situated 6 miles north of Falelatai Reef.
